What are sustainable socks?
Sustainable socks are socks that are manufactured in an environmentally friendly and sustainable manner. This may include using sustainably sourced materials such as organic cotton or recycled fibres, adopting more environmentally friendly production practices and implementing resource conservation measures. Sustainable socks may also be biodegradable or compostable, meaning they can decompose naturally in the environment rather than accumulating in landfills.
